1993 Oldsmobile Cutlass vs. 2010 Fiat Ducato

To start off, 2010 Fiat Ducato is newer by 17 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1993 Oldsmobile Cutlass.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1993 Oldsmobile Cutlass would be higher. At 3,135 cc (6 cylinders), 1993 Oldsmobile Cutlass is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2010 Fiat Ducato (161 HP @ 3600 RPM) has 23 more horse power than 1993 Oldsmobile Cutlass. (138 HP @ 4500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2010 Fiat Ducato should accelerate faster than 1993 Oldsmobile Cutlass.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1993 Oldsmobile Cutlass weights approximately 554 kg more than 2010 Fiat Ducato.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2010 Fiat Ducato (320 Nm @ 2000 RPM) has 90 more torque (in Nm) than 1993 Oldsmobile Cutlass. (230 Nm @ 3600 RPM). This means 2010 Fiat Ducato will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1993 Oldsmobile Cutlass. 1993 Oldsmobile Cutlass has automatic transmission and 2010 Fiat Ducato has manual transmission. 2010 Fiat Ducato will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 1993 Oldsmobile Cutlass will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
